Dover High School helps students get Passport to Success

Dover High students take the day off from classes to learn more about earning a Passport to Success.  Organized by the school’s Parent Teacher Organization and is designed to help students learn about self development, explore careers and other post-high school opportunities.  A handful of 8th graders from Central Middle School are also taking part in the program.
